can you fly with disposable vapes in the United States?
Regulations prioritize fire safety. We treat battery-equipped nicotine devices as portable electronics and follow TSA/FAA baseline rules. Keep these items in carry-on luggage; they are not permitted in checked luggage due to lithium battery hazards.
Quick TSA-aligned answer for carry-on vs. checked bags
Short takeaway: Transport devices only in carry-on luggage. Screening is required, and officers may inspect or request removal for separate screening.
Why airlines treat these differently than other tobacco items
Traditional cigarettes and cigars lack integrated batteries. That difference drives stricter controls for battery devices.
- Why: A battery fire in cargo limits crew response compared to the cabin.
- Security interaction: State the device is an e-cigarette or vape when asked and follow officer instructions.
- Variation: Major airlines usually mirror TSA/FAA, but airline policy layers exist—verify before travel.
Note: Destination country laws may be stricter; check local possession and public-use rules before departure.
Why disposable vapes are treated as lithium-ion battery devices
Battery chemistry, not nicotine, drives how airlines classify these products. Regulators view many single-use nicotine units as electronic items because they include lithium cells. That classification shapes airport rules on transport.
The fire-risk reason these items don’t go in checked luggage
At the cell level, a short or damage can cause *thermal runaway*. Heat builds quickly. The result is rapid overheating, smoke, or fire.
In cargo, fires are harder to detect and control. That is why lithium-ion batteries are restricted from checked bags on an airplane.
What “portable electronic device” rules mean here
Regulators treat small electronics the same way. If an item has an internal lithium-ion battery, it is a PED and must stay in cabin carry-on.
Accidental activation is a real risk. Pressure on a mouthpiece, an airflow sensor, or a stray button press can energize the cell. Even sealed, unused units keep the same travel status.
| Risk | What happens | Packed location |
|---|---|---|
| Short circuit | Rapid heating, smoke | Carry-on (cabin) |
| Physical damage | Cell puncture, thermal event | Carry-on (visible) |
| Accidental activation | Battery discharge, heat | Carry-on, powered off |
| Leak or pressurization | Fluid escape, corrosion | Carry-on in sealed bag |
Our rule of thumb: treat each unit like a small electronic device. That simple mental model improves packing choices and overall safety.
TSA and FAA carry-on rules for disposable vapes
We treat these items as small electronics under cabin rules. Carry-on placement is mandatory. Follow simple steps to pass screening and avoid delays.
Where to pack devices so they pass screening smoothly
Place devices in the top layer of your personal item or main carry-on luggage. Keep them visible for quick removal if officers ask.
How to prevent accidental activation in your bag
Power off devices when possible. Use a small hard case or seal them in a clear pouch. Separate from coins, keys, and chargers to avoid ambiguous X-ray images.
What to do if TSA asks you to take devices out
Remain calm. Present the items and state they are disposable vapes. Follow instructions and avoid arguing policy at the checkpoint. If asked, show any packaging or proof of purchase.

Checked luggage restrictions and what can go in your suitcase
Airline luggage rules separate powered units from liquid containers for safety reasons.
Non-negotiable rule: any device with an internal lithium cell must remain in cabin carry-on. The integrated battery is the restriction driver, not the e-liquid itself. Packing such a device in checked baggage creates an avoidable fire risk.
What may go in a suitcase: sealed e-liquid bottles are often allowed in checked bags, depending on airline and destination rules. Extra bottles should meet transport rules for liquids and be clearly labeled.
Leak prevention and pressure tips
Pressurization changes on a flight can force liquid past weak seals. That can ruin clothing and damage electronics.
- Double-bag bottles in clear plastic to contain leaks.
- Keep upright when possible and leave headspace in partially filled containers.
- Use rigid cases for bottles and separate them from fragile items.
- Label nicotine liquids and keep receipts to reduce inspection delays.
“Protecting fabric and gear from leaks is a practical step that lowers stress at both security and arrival.”
These are packing best practices, not legal guarantees. Airline and destination restrictions may vary. We recommend verifying rules before any flight.

How many disposable vapes can you bring on a plane?
Airport staff focus on intent—personal use versus commercial transport—when reviewing multiple units. Federal agencies rarely publish strict numeric caps. Instead, officers look for signs of resale or bulk shipping.

Personal-use limits versus extra scrutiny
Personal use usually means a handful of items for the trip. Carrying large counts may prompt questions about resale. Some carriers reference ranges like 15–20 units as an informal benchmark, but policies vary.
How battery quantity affects carry-on handling
Each unit adds lithium cells. More batteries increase the chance of extra screening or denial. Keep items in carry-on luggage so cabin crew can respond to any issue.
- Pack: separate units, avoid metal contact.
- Document: keep receipts to show personal purchase.
- Present: answer security questions calmly and clearly.

E-liquid and liquid limits at airport security
TSA liquid rules focus on container size and visibility, not the product name on the label.
We follow the 100 ml standard for carry-on bottles. Each container must be 100 ml (3.4 oz) or less. Place all liquid containers inside a clear, resealable plastic bag for screening.
The 100 ml rule and how it applies to vape juice
Prefilled nicotine units remain a separate item but may be treated like liquids if officers ask. Extra e-liquid bottles must meet the 100 ml per container rule and fit inside the single quart-size bag per passenger.
Clear, resealable plastic bag best practices for liquids
Pack smart: keep labels visible and caps tight. Isolate bottles from electronics to reduce secondary inspections and mess if a leak occurs.
Keep liquid items accessible at the checkpoint. That speeds screening and lowers the chance of a hands-on search. Different airports apply these regulations with slight variation, so neat presentation reduces friction.

Can you vape on a plane or in an airport?
Vaping inside an aircraft is banned worldwide and carries real operational and legal consequences. Attempting to vape on a plane risks fines, confiscation, crew intervention, and even diversion of the flight. Alarms and smoke detectors on modern aircraft are sensitive and treat vapor incidents like any smoking event.
Why vaping is prohibited on aircraft worldwide
Regulators group vaping under existing smoking bans for safety reasons. Smoke detectors and avionics cannot reliably distinguish aerosol from smoke.
That triggers emergency responses. The result may include passenger interviews, enforcement action, or an unscheduled landing.
Finding designated smoking areas at US airports
Most airports restrict vaping to designated smoking areas, usually outside terminals or in clearly marked outdoor zones. Assume airport smoking rules apply to vaping.
Before clearing security, check airport maps and the website for smoking areas and terminal signage. For connections, remember airside options are often limited.
- Hard rule: no onboard use — never attempt stealth vaping in restrooms or at gates.
- Detection: alarms, crew reports, and CCTV can identify incidents quickly.
- Practical tip: plan nicotine management before boarding and locate designated smoking areas before security.

How to pack disposable vapes for air travel without leaks or damage
A good packing plan prevents leaks, accidental activation, and needless delays at security. Place all units in your carry-on. Cabin placement reduces crush risk and lets crew respond if an issue occurs.

Carry-on placement that reduces pressure and crushing
Use a rigid pocket or small hard case inside your personal item. Do not leave items loose at the bottom of an overstuffed bag.
Keep units upright where possible to limit mouthpiece contamination and seepage during pressurization changes.
Using a protective case and separating devices from metal items
Choose a case that cushions impact. Physically separate devices from keys, coins, and chargers to lower short-circuit risk and cosmetic damage.
Keeping devices powered off and secured during the flight
Power off or lock supported units. For draw-activated designs, protect the mouthpiece to avoid airflow-triggered activation.
Travel checklist for a stress-free security line
- Count devices and keep receipts to show personal use.
- Bag liquids in clear resealable pouches per 100 ml rules.
- Keep chargers separate and labeled.
- Confirm airline rules before departure and keep items accessible at screening.

Charging and recharging rules on travel days
Charging devices during a trip should be deliberate and safety-first, not an afterthought at a gate or on board. We advise against charging on an aircraft. Crew may view setup or cable use as an attempt to operate the unit and treat it as a security issue.
Can you charge a vape on a plane?
Short answer: generally avoid charging onboard. Taking a unit out mid-flight can escalate into a compliance matter. It may draw crew attention and lead to confiscation or fines.
How to recharge safely with USB-C devices before boarding
- Top off before arrival: fill batteries at home or at a gate outlet before screening.
- Use quality cables: reputable USB‑C cables and certified chargers lower heat and short risks.
- Avoid public ports: airport USB hubs may be damaged or supply unstable power.
- Don’t leave charging unattended: monitor charge cycles and remove the device when full.

How to know if your disposable vape is empty while traveling
Recognizing end-of-life cues prevents burned hits and safety issues on a trip. We focus on quick, practical checks so travelers keep comfort and safety first.
Common signs that a unit is empty
Muted flavor or a sudden loss of taste is usually the first sign.
Reduced vapor and a weaker draw may mean low liquid or a dying battery; assess both when troubleshooting.
Harsher draw or an unpleasant throat sting often signals nearing empty.
Blinking lights on indicator models normally mark low battery or fault; check the manual if unsure.
What dry hits mean and why to stop use
Dry hits occur when the coil heats without sufficient liquid. The result is a burnt taste and throat irritation.
Stop use immediately after a dry hit. Continued operation raises heat stress on cells and coils and reduces safety.
- Bring one backup product instead of pushing a nearly empty unit.
- Keep receipts and proper disposal info; do not discard lithium battery devices in regular trash where prohibited.

Core technical specs to look for in a travel disposable
We focus on fundamentals that affect trip comfort and safety. Read spec labels before purchase. Prioritize low-maintenance, predictable products for travel.
Battery capacity (mAh)
mAh: larger values mean longer runtime. For long layovers, aim for 800–1500 mAh for single-use style products. Higher capacity reduces the need to recharge at a gate.
E-liquid volume (ml) and puffs
ml: typical values range from 3–20 ml. Expect marketing puff counts to vary by draw length and airflow. Plan real puffs by assuming shorter, mouth-to-lung draws use fewer ml.
Nicotine strength: 2% vs 5%
Choose 2% (20 mg/ml) for smoother frequent draws. Choose 5% (50 mg/ml) to reduce total draws. Match strength to travel style and destination rules.
Coil type: mesh vs dual mesh
Mesh offers smooth, efficient vapor. Dual mesh sustains flavor at higher output and resists early taste drift. For multi-leg trips, dual mesh often holds flavor longer.
Charging port: USB‑C
Prefer USB‑C for durable connectors and common cables. Fully charge devices before heading to security to avoid mid-journey charging decisions. Make sure backups are documented.
